File servers are here to stay. Here’s how to manage them securely
In the sprawling digital cosmos, file servers remain stubbornly immortal—quiet gravitational anchors around which entire IT ecosystems orbit. But as user permissions accumulate like cosmic dust, the once-simple act of granting access spirals into a labyrinthine tangle of over-privileged accounts and shadowy openings. tenfold Software’s five best practices offer a navigational star chart for weary administrators, mapping a path toward least-privilege access and secure file server governance—proving that even the most mundane infrastructure can harbor hidden depths of complexity worth exploring.
